Empty trucks reduce efficiency and cost carbon credits

At large logistics operations such as PSA Singapore, truck resource optimization and intelligent automation now go hand-in-hand with sustainability mandates

In a large-scale logistics facility involving hundreds of goods vehicles, how can technology be used to optimize scheduling to maximize the efficiency of drivers and trucking resources?

At PSA Singapore — one of the world’s busiest ports in terms of container volume — decades of experience in managing trucking efficiency had reached a plateau even with constant modernization.

A further digital transformation was needed, which would be turn-key in implementation; not labor- or training- intensive; customizable and sustainability-focused.

The solution that fit these specifications was found: a cloud-based transport management solution with features like automated scheduling and asset pooling for truck drivers. The system allocates jobs to drivers based on their location, offering real-time optimization of routes and truck assignments. This not only minimizes empty runs (i.e., truck trips without any freight loaded onboard) , but also ensures that drivers are allocated jobs in proximity to their current location.

The solution improves overall transit and waiting times, drivers’ well-being and operational efficiency, while reducing carbon emission. Firms that adopted this solution have been able to demonstrate about 50% reduction in empty runs, which translates into an annual reduction of approximately 10m kilograms of carbon emissions in a year.
